It's in fact the primary repressive neurotransmitter system in brain circuits. Gamma-Aminobutyric Acid is a relaxation neurotransmitter that the body produces naturally when we're preparing to sleep, so the method of using GABA supplements to signify the brain that it's time to soothe down makes good sense - how to de stress and reduce anxiety. What's not absolutely clear, nevertheless, is how reliable oral GABA supplements remain in setting off those advantages.

While some research studies have shown that GABA can cross the blood-brain barrier, others have revealed the opposite, recommending a possible placebo impact behind perceived advantages of the supplements. Researchers agree that more research study is required to identify how beneficial GABA supplements truly are. According to NuCalm's website, the disc "simplifies the process of triggering the parasympathetic worried system, by taking advantage of the body's Pericardium Meridian with specific electromagnetic (EM) frequencies." The disc (which, again, was a round sticker, about the size of a quarter, that was applied to the inside of my wrist) was, undoubtedly, my biggest source of uncertainty in the procedure, and NuCalm's official description of the science behind it highlights the most Brand-new Age-y vibes of the business.

It is assumed that if you can restore the frequencies that take a trip through the Meridians you can reinstate optimum physiology. Each NuCalm disc holds the EM frequency patterns of GABA and its precursors to deliver a pure biological signal to your body. When put on the within of your left wrist, at your Pericardium-6 acupuncture point, the disc sends a signal to the pericardium of your heart to activate regional parasympathetic nerve fibers, which then transmit the signal to your brain telling it to increase vagal nerve output and begin the procedure of decreasing the body.

In 2017, Gwyneth Paltrow's GOOP promoted a $120 brand name of bio-frequency sticker labels, causing a short-term viral minute for the tech. reduce stress. Sadly for advocates of the devices, the response wasn't fantastic, with Mark Shelhamer, former chief researcher at NASA's human research department, significantly decrying the GOOP-endorsed product as "snake oil." Although the NuCalm site describes that "each disc holds the electro-magnetic frequency patterns of GABA and its precursors to provide a pure biosignal to your body," it's not clear precisely how placing the sticker on your wrist activates that shipment.
